Fireball: It’s Not Just a Terrible Whiskey Anymore

Tonight I’m going to a local board game café (which is apparently a thing) to see some guys who are crowdfunding a remake of the 1986 board game, Fireball Island. It was played on a three-dimensional board in which you tried to be the first off the island with a bigass ruby. But your friends can draw cards to rain flaming hell (red marbles) down upon you in the island’s narrow paths. It was awesome, and I’m psyched. Also, flavored whiskey sucks.
